Description
This stunning detached property is now available for sale in a desirable location boasting an array of appealing features. The house is neutrally decorated, creating a blank canvas for personal touches. With two reception rooms, this home offers ample space for both relaxing and entertaining. The open-plan kitchen is a chef's dream, complete with a kitchen island, modern appliances, and a separate utility room.
The property comprises four bedrooms, including a spacious master bedroom with an en-suite and built-in wardrobes, two additional double bedrooms flooded with natural light, and a single bedroom. There are three well-appointed bathrooms, including a family bathroom, an en-suite shower room, and a downstairs W/C.
Situated in a tranquil area with green spaces, walking and cycling routes, this home is ideally suited for families and couples. The beautiful garden provides a serene retreat, complemented by a garage and parking space. Noteworthy features include a fireplace, creating a cosy ambiance, and a beautiful view to enjoy.
